
The haunting call of a loon is one of nature's most distinctive and evocative sounds, often associated with the serene beauty of northern lakes. Resembling a mix of wails, yodels, and tremolos, the loon's vocalizations are both eerie and mesmerizing, echoing across the water with a wild, otherworldly quality. Each call serves a purpose, from territorial warnings to mating signals, and their unique timbre is shaped by the bird's anatomy and the acoustics of its environment. Hearing a loon's call is not just an auditory experience but a visceral connection to the wilderness, evoking a sense of solitude, mystery, and the timeless rhythms of the natural world.

Distinctive Tremolo Call: Rapid, clear, wavering notes, often described as a crazy laugh
The tremolo call of a loon is a sound that demands attention, a rapid-fire sequence of notes that seems to teeter on the edge of chaos. Imagine a series of clear, wavering tones, each one slightly off-kilter, strung together in a rhythm that feels both deliberate and frenzied. This call, often likened to a crazy laugh, is not just a random noise but a complex vocalization that serves multiple purposes in the loon’s life. It’s a sound that can travel long distances across water, making it an effective alarm or territorial declaration. For anyone listening, it’s a striking auditory experience that lingers in the memory, a hallmark of the loon’s presence in its habitat.
To truly appreciate the tremolo call, consider its structure. The call typically consists of 6 to 10 notes per second, each note distinct yet blending into the next in a wavering pattern. This isn’t a smooth, melodic tune but a jagged, almost manic sequence that captures the listener’s attention immediately. Birdwatchers and nature enthusiasts often describe it as a sound that feels both wild and controlled, a paradox that reflects the loon’s enigmatic nature. To identify it in the field, focus on the clarity of the notes and the rapid, uneven rhythm—it’s less like a song and more like a vocalized exclamation point.
If you’re trying to mimic the tremolo call for observational purposes, start by practicing a series of short, clear notes with a slight waver. Use your diaphragm to maintain the rapid pace, and don’t worry about perfection—the call’s charm lies in its raw, unpolished quality. A practical tip: listen to recordings of the tremolo call before attempting to replicate it. Pay attention to the timing and the way the notes seem to “shake.” While mimicking the call won’t bring loons to you, it can deepen your understanding of their vocalizations and enhance your connection to their world.
Comparing the tremolo call to other loon vocalizations highlights its uniqueness. Unlike the haunting yodel or the soft hoots, the tremolo is a call of urgency, often used when a loon feels threatened or needs to assert dominance. Its distinctiveness lies not just in its sound but in its context—it’s a call that conveys emotion, whether aggression, alarm, or even excitement. This makes it a fascinating subject for study, offering insights into loon behavior and communication. For researchers, analyzing the tremolo’s variations can reveal patterns in loon interactions and responses to environmental changes.

Hooting Sound: Deep, rhythmic, owl-like hoots, typically heard during breeding season
The haunting hooting sound of a loon is a defining feature of its vocal repertoire, particularly during the breeding season. This deep, rhythmic call, often likened to the hoot of an owl, serves as a territorial declaration and a means of attracting mates. Unlike the yodel, which is a complex, tremolo-like call used by males to establish dominance, the hoot is simpler yet equally powerful. It typically consists of a series of two to three low-pitched notes, each lasting about a second, repeated at regular intervals. This sound carries far across water, making it an effective way for loons to communicate in their aquatic habitats.
To fully appreciate the hooting sound, consider its context. During the breeding season, which peaks in late spring and early summer, loons become more vocal as they establish and defend their territories. The hoot is often heard at dawn and dusk, when the air is calm and sound travels best. For birdwatchers or nature enthusiasts, identifying this call can be a rewarding experience. A practical tip is to use a field guide or a bird sound app to compare recordings, ensuring accurate identification. Listening for the hoot’s distinct rhythm and depth can help distinguish it from other loon calls or similar bird sounds.
From an analytical perspective, the hooting sound reveals much about loon behavior and ecology. Its rhythmic pattern is not arbitrary; it likely evolved to maximize clarity and minimize overlap with other vocalizations. The low frequency of the hoot allows it to travel long distances without losing its integrity, a crucial adaptation for birds that inhabit vast, open waters. Interestingly, studies have shown that the pitch and duration of hoots can vary slightly between individuals, potentially serving as a unique identifier for mates or rivals. This subtle variation underscores the complexity of loon communication, even in a seemingly simple call.

A loon produces a variety of calls, including a haunting wail, a yodeling trill, and a low, mournful hoot.
The wail is a long, rising and falling call that sounds eerie and melodic, often echoing across lakes and forests.
Yes, loons use distinct calls for communication, such as territorial defense, mating, and alerting others to danger.
The loon’s call can be quite loud and carries over long distances, especially the wail and yodel.
Yes, a loon’s call is designed to travel, and it can often be heard from several miles away, especially in calm, open environments.
